At PGI Signs and AD PROS vehicle vinyl is one of our specialties. We offer the following:

  • Full Vehicle Wraps – This involves wrapping the entire vehicle and very often, adding perforated window graphics that are see-through.
  • Partial Vehicle Wraps – Here, only a portion of the vehicle receives vinyl graphics. You can still do a lot with partial wraps if you’re looking for a more affordable option.
  • Spot Graphics and Lettering – Another cost-effective way to use vehicle vinyl is by adding spot graphics and lettering on specific spaces. This might be to the doors, front hood and rear windows, for example.
  • Decals – These are just like they sound. Decals can be a product image, a symbol, even a QR code.
  • Vehicle Striping – For those looking to add stripes on their personal or business vehicle, we can help with that.
  • Custom Vehicle Graphics – Included in this category would be matte color wraps and color change wraps. We can also help if you have a modified vehicle and need vehicle graphics.
